Jharkhand HC asks Deoghar DC to serve demolition notice to owners of 9 high-rise buildings around airport

Ranchi, Sept 27: The Jharkhand High Court today directed Deoghar DC Manjunath Bhajantri to serve demolition notice to the owner of 9 high-rise buildings around Deoghar airport and report the development to the court.

A division bench comprising Chief Justice Dr Ravi Ranjan and Justice S N Prasad gave the direction while hearing a contempt petition filed by Godda MP Nishikant Dubey.

Dubey filed the contempt petition through his lawyer Diwakar Upadhyay after the district administration in Deoghar failed to ensure proper operation of the airport though it had submitted before the high court during the hearing of a PIL in 2013 that it will be needed to get the airport operational.

Dubey knocked the court saying the district administration so far even failed to demolish the nine high-rise buildings which should not exist around the airport. Apart from this, he said a night land facility is yet to be started at the airport.
